What Is B2B Appointment Setting?

B2B appointment setting is an important part of the sales process, as it involves prospecting, identifying, approaching, and qualifying potential buyers to schedule meetings between them and a sales representative. It is a time-consuming process and requires a strong understanding of the target market, good communication skills, and effective sales process management.

Manual appointment setting can be intensive and time-consuming and often involves cold calling prospects, researching potential buyers, and following up with prospects. To make the process more efficient, appointment setting solutions can help to streamline the process and make it easier to reach out to potential buyers quickly and efficiently.

Successful B2B appointment setting can increase sales opportunities and better relationships with potential buyers. It is important to have a clear understanding of the target market, good communication skills, and a well-defined sales process to be successful in B2B appointment setting. With the help of appointment setting solutions, the process can be streamlined and made more efficient and cost-effective, leading to increased sales opportunities and better customer relationships.

Making Cold and Warm Calls

Cold calling is an effective way to reach potential customers and set up appointments. It’s important to be prepared and have a clear goal in mind when making the call, as well as having qualification points and a script ready to ensure you stay on track and focus on the customer’s needs. Before making the call, research the potential customer to ensure you are making an informed call and have the necessary information to make the call successful. Don’t be afraid to ask questions during the call; this will help better understand the customer’s needs. Be polite and professional throughout the call, and don’t be discouraged if the customer isn’t interested or has no time for an appointment.

Warm calls can also effectively set appointments as the customer is already familiar with your company. When making a warm call, emphasize the benefits of setting up an appointment. Crafting Personalized Emails

In B2B appointment setting, personalized emails are an important tool for standing out from the competition. Instead of using a generic email template, it is important to tailor the message to the individual customer or prospect. This can be done by including the customer’s name, company name, and relevant industry information. In the email, focus on the customer’s needs and emphasize the value your product or service can bring to their business. It is also beneficial to showcase your knowledge of the customer’s industry by referencing recent news or trends that could influence their decisions.

When crafting the message, keep it concise and to the point. Customers often receive many emails and may not have the time or patience to read a long-winded message. Finally, include a call-to-action at the end of the message, such as requesting a meeting or offering a free consultation. This will help to ensure that the customer takes the desired action.

Requesting LinkedIn Connections

Making successful connections with potential leads in the b2b appointment setting market is essential for success. LinkedIn is a great resource for connecting with decision-makers and other influential contacts in your industry. With its advanced search capabilities, you can find contacts that match your criteria for a successful b2b appointment.

When connecting with potential leads on LinkedIn, it is important to send personalized connection requests that explain the value of connecting with you. Leverage the messaging feature to further engage with your connections and make your request for a b2b appointment. You can also use the endorsement feature to increase your credibility and make your connection requests more compelling.

Top Skills of a Person in the Appointment Setter Role

B2B appointment setting is a critical component of any successful sales team. It requires specialized skills and qualifications, such as excellent communication skills, superior customer service experience, and marketing and sales strategies knowledge. Furthermore, the ideal candidate should be able to anticipate customer needs, work independently, and be proficient in using CRM software.

Lead generation techniques should also be well-known to an outbound appointment setter and the ability to handle difficult conversations and identify potential sales opportunities. It is essential that the appoint setter can assess customer requirements quickly and have excellent organizational skills to prioritize tasks. Lastly, the appointment setter should be able to work in a fast-paced environment.
